Is Agate Travel worth it? The data verdict
Agate Travel rates 4.80★ across 224 verified reviews — genuinely good, short of exceptional. Its trips run about £274/day — pricier than the market median. The complaints below are consistent enough to take seriously before booking.
Where Agate Travel scores
What travellers consistently praise
- Knowledgeable, warm guides
- Responsive customer service (WhatsApp support)
- Smooth transport and logistics
- Good value tailor-made itineraries
- Staff go out of their way to fix problems
The consistent complaints
- Inconsistent accommodation quality
- Itineraries sometimes overpacked/exhausting
- Occasional under-briefed guides on niche sites
- Group size or check-in issues not always handled proactively
